How did he botch it?
When the fins were deciding what to do on the last drive against GB Philbin had them change strategy after the first play. They ran on first down, which was smart since GB was out of TOs, but then they decided to pass on 2nd down. You cant have your coach making panic moves in situations like that.
Against the Lions on first down the Fins ran for 4, then on 2nd down they tried to run a shotgun draw that got stuff, and on 3rd down they passed and threw an incompletion. The Lions marched down the field and won with no time left. The Fins should have ran on 3rd down and made the Lions use their last TO.
